Metamask签名详解:如何安全有效地使用数字钱包进

      时间:2026-02-16 13:01:45

      主页 > 最新教程 >

      
              

        在数字货币和区块链的世界里,Metamask无疑是最受欢迎的数字钱包之一。作为一种非托管式的钱包,Metamask允许用户安全地存储和管理他们的加密资产,同时提供简洁易用的用户界面。对于任何使用Metamask的用户而言,理解和掌握签名的概念与操作至关重要。

        签名在区块链中通常是指通过公钥密码学技术,加密用户的操作记录或信息,确保这些信息的不可篡改和确认真实性。特别是在进行交易时,Metamask需要用户对交易的相关信息进行签名,以保证只有真正的账户拥有者才能进行交易。通过这种方式,用户不仅能够确保交易的安全性,还能有效防止欺诈和盗窃行为。

        Metamask简介

        Metamask是一个以太坊及ERC20代币的浏览器扩展钱包,此外它也支持代币的管理和去中心化应用(DApp)的访问。用户可以通过Metamask与以太坊网络直接交互,无需下载整个区块链,极大地减少了用户的进入门槛。

        除去办法,它还提供了一系列功能,包括交易签名、资产转换以及与各种DApp的无缝对接,使用户能够在一个平台上完成不同类型的操作。这种便捷性,加上当前加密货币市场的热度,使得Metamask越来越受到用户的青睐。

        Metamask签名的原理

        在区块链技术中,签名是一种确保信息完整性与发起人身份的机制。Metamask所依赖的数字签名原理采用了非对称加密算法,包括公钥和私钥。简单来说,用户在创建Metamask账户时,会生成一对密钥:私钥和公钥。

        用户的私钥是保密的、仅供个人使用,而公钥则是加密用的地址,其他人可以通过公钥向用户发送交易。当用户要进行交易时,Metamask会使用私钥对交易信息进行签名,这样可以确保交易的真实来源及信息的安全性。网络中的其他节点通过公钥对签名进行验证,确认信息的有效性。

        如何在Metamask中进行签名

        在Metamask中进行签名的过程相对简单。首先,用户需要确保Metamask已经正确安装并且已登录。

        1. **打开Metamask**:在浏览器中找到Metamask扩展图标,点击以打开钱包。

        2. **查看待签名交易**:在钱包的主界面,用户可以看到交易记录和待处理的交易。在待处理交易中,会显示需要签名的相关信息。

        3. **发起交易**:如果是主动发起交易,用户只需输入交易的详细信息(如接收地址、金额等),并确认交易。

        4. **签名确认**:在交易确认步骤中,Metamask会要求用户进行签名。在此之前,用户可能需要输入密码来确保交易的安全性。一旦输入正确,系统将自动使用用户的私钥对交易进行签名。

        5. **提交交易**:签名完成后,用户可以提交交易。此时已签名的交易信息将被发送到区块链网络中等待被记录和确认。

        Metamask签名的安全性

        尽管Metamask为用户提供了便捷的签名功能,但用户仍需了解与之相关的安全风险。因为私钥的泄露意味着账户的所有权也随之失去,可能导致数字资产被盗。因此,以下几点安全措施尤为重要:

        1. **保护私钥**:用户需妥善保管自己的私钥,绝不可泄露给任何人。避免在不安全的环境中输入私钥。

        2. **使用强密码**:为Metamask设置一个复杂且独特的密码,再加上两步验证功能,大幅提高账户的安全性。

        3. **定期备份**:定期备份钱包的重要信息,例如助记词和私钥,防止因设备丢失或损坏而造成的资产损失。

        4. **关注钓鱼攻击**:在使用Metamask过程中,时刻警惕钓鱼网站,确保访问的是官方网站或已知的DApp,避免在假网站上输入密码和私钥。

        关于Metamask签名的6个常见问题

        什么是签名,为什么在Metamask中重要?

        在区块链中,签名是验证交易和信息完整性的关键。对于Metamask用户而言,签名不仅用于交易,还可用于认证、授权和数据验证。通过签名,用户能够确保自己账户中的资产不被他人未授权使用,增加交易的透明度和安全性。

        签名能够有效地防止交易篡改,确保信息在传递过程中的完整性。例如,当用户对交易进行签名时,交易的详情会被加密。如果有人试图更改交易内容,则签名将无法验证,交易将被拒绝,确保用户的资产安全。

        如何避免私钥泄露?

        私钥是控制用户资产的关键,没有它任何人都无法访问用户的资产。但是,私钥如果被不法分子获取,将会面临巨大的财产损失风险。因此,用户需要采取若干措施来保护私钥:首先,确保私钥存储在安全的地方,可以选择使用冷存储(例如纸质钱包或硬件钱包)。此外,用户应定期检查他们的设备和网络环境,使用防火墙和反病毒软件,及时更新组件以避免安全隐患。

        Metamask的签名过程是否容易理解?

        Metamask的签名过程相对简单,用户只需了解基本的交易流程。用户在交易中只需提供接收方地址和发送金额,系统会自动提供签名请求。使用隐私保护功能的用户也能了解交易的细节,可确保了解他们的资金用途和目的

        为了简化用户体验,Metamask提供了直观的图形界面,步骤清晰明了,用户可以更轻松了解整个签名过程。即使是初学者也能在平台的引导下完成交易签名。

        在签名过程中可能遇到哪些问题?

        在Metamask签名过程中,用户可能会遇到多种问题。首先,网络不稳定或服务节点故障可能导致签名延迟。其次,用户可能会由于输入错误而取消交易。最后,部分用户可能会在DApp中遭遇未授权请求,恶意应用可能伪装成正常交易,因此,建议用户在签名前充分审查交易信息

        如何查看历史签名记录和交易?

        用户可以通过Metamask钱包接口查看过往的所有签名记录和交易。进入钱包主页,用户可以找到“历史交易”选项,里面详细列出了所有的签名操作及相关数据。若用户希望更深入了解某一笔交易,可以点击进入查看该交易的详细信息。

        使用Metamask的签名功能进行去中心化交易有何优势?

        使用Metamask的签名功能进行去中心化交易有多方面的优势。首先,用户可以直接与区块链交互,无需中介,也无需信任他人。此外,交易的透明度和不可篡改性都能保护用户的财产安全。在DApp使用过程中,Metamask所提供的安全保护措施能有效防止安全漏洞及 টাকাного обмена下的其他潜在威胁。

        总之,Metamask签名是一个强大而安全的功能,掌握了这一功能的使用方法及背后的原理,用户不仅能更好地管理数字资产,还能有效减少因操作不当而造成的损失。要在快速发展的加密世界中立足,了解如何正确使用Metamask的签名功能至关重要。